Rational Dividend Fund Summary

Rational Dividend competes with Putnam Global, Janus Global, Dreyfus Technology, Goldman Sachs, and Franklin Biotechnology. The fund will invest at least 80 percent of its net assets, plus the amount of borrowings for investment purposes, in equity securities. It seeks to achieve its investment objective by investing primarily in the common stock of dividend paying companies included within the SP 500 Index. The fund may also invest in exchange traded funds .

Rational Dividend Capture Systematic Risk

Rational Dividend's systematic risk plays a vital role in portfolio allocation when considering its stock to be added to a well-diversified portfolio. Rational Dividend volatility which cannot be eliminated through diversification, requires returns over the risk-free rate. Over the long run, a well-diversified portfolio provides returns that match its exposure to systematic risk. In this case, investors face a trade-off between expected returns and systematic risk and, therefore, can only reduce a portfolio's exposure to systematic risk by sacrificing expected returns on the portfolio.

The Beta measures systematic risk based on how returns on Rational Dividend Capture correlated with the market. If Beta is less than 0 Rational Dividend generally moves in the opposite direction as compared to the market. If Rational Dividend Beta is about zero movement of price series is uncorrelated with the movement of the benchmark. if Beta is between zero and one Rational Dividend Capture is generally moves in the same direction as, but less than the movement of the market. For Beta = 1 movement of Rational Dividend is generally in the same direction as the market. If Beta > 1 Rational Dividend moves generally in the same direction as, but more than the movement of the benchmark.
